Logs & Lumber Ltd. Approach to FSC Forest Certification

Logs & Lumber Ltd. embraced the concept of FSC Forest Certification under the Smartwood certification programme in 2006. The company became a registered participant of the WWF-Global Forest & Trade Network (GFTN) the same year. This initiative was in response to the global market demand that seeks to ensure that Timber producing companies demonstrate their compliance with international standards for responsible forestry and that their operations are sustainable in the long term.

The company envisages the following benefits from being certified:

Increases its market share
Encourages minimization of waste in harvesting and onsite processing
Provides competitive advantage
Improves public image of the company
Ensure compliance with local and international treaties
Better access to higher value markets
and above all promotes sustainability of the company through sustainable forest management

HIGH CONSERVATION VALUE FORESTS (HCVFs)

In order to demonstrate the company’s commitment to protecting conservation values in its forests, the company has trained its stock survey team on how to identify HCVs. This led to the identification of the bareheaded rock fowl in the Nkrabea Forest Reserve. The findings were corroborated by Ghana Wildlife Society (GWS). Recently, the company contracted ProForest to carry out HCVs assessment in all its Concessions/TUC areas, which has since been completed.

SOCIAL RESPONSIBILITY AGREEMENT

LLL is committed to addressing the social needs of its Forest Fringe communities, and other surrounding communities within its processing plant. Several infrastructural developmental have taken place over the years. The company has over the years maintained a cordial relationship with all its fringe and surrounding communities.

COMMUNITY EDUCATION PROGRAMMES

The company has in recent times been carrying out community sensitization programmes in Social Responsibility Agreement, Sustainable Forest Management and with WWF-GFTN

REDUCE IMPACT LOGGING TRAINING BY FORM INTERNATIONAL

To ensure that our logging is environmentally responsible and conforms to high environmental standards, Reduce Impact Logging training was conducted for all our logging teams by FORM International Netherlands.
